英英释义
spire[ \'spaiə ]n.a tall tower that forms the superstructure of a building (usually a church or temple) and that tapers to a point at the top
同义词:steeple

spire词源
spire (n.)
Old English spir \"a sprout, shoot, spike, blade, tapering stalk of grass,\" from Proto-Germanic *spiraz (cognates: Old Norse spira \"a stalk, slender tree,\" Dutch spier \"shoot, blade of grass,\" Middle Low German spir \"a small point or top\"), from PIE *spei- \"sharp point\" (see spike (n.1)). Meaning \"tapering top of a tower or steeple\" first recorded 1590s (a sense attested in Middle Low German since late 14c. and also found in the Scandinavian cognates).
spire (v.)
early 14c., \"send up shoots,\" from spire (n.). Related: Spired; spiring.
